diff options
Diffstat (limited to 'PKGBUILD')
-rw-r--r-- | PKGBUILD | 27 |
1 files changed, 11 insertions, 16 deletions
@@ -1,43 +1,38 @@ # Maintainer: Bryn Edwards <bryn@protonmail.ch> pkgname=antibody -pkgver=3.4.6 +pkgver=3.5.0 pkgrel=1 pkgdesc="A shell plugin manager." arch=('i686' 'x86_64') url="https://getantibody.github.io/" license=('MIT') -makedepends=('go') +makedepends=('go' 'dep') source=("https://github.com/getantibody/antibody/archive/v${pkgver}.tar.gz") -sha256sums=('985875bd8ffc8dc8ae421c4f3becfd55cd147ca3a3e30513158ef7048fae8a6d') -_repodir=(".go/src/github.com/getantibody") +sha256sums=('0c774cf2d7e29293b1ca2ad1c05d4c8a4226a2956be1f7c50cb2c8456a88810d') +_repodir=(".go/src") prepare() { export GOPATH="$srcdir/.go" - export PATH="$GOPATH/bin:$PATH" - mkdir -p "$srcdir/.go/src/github.com/getantibody" + mkdir -p "$srcdir/$_repodir" ln -sf "$srcdir/$pkgname-$pkgver" \ "$srcdir/$_repodir/$pkgname" cd "$srcdir/$_repodir/$pkgname" sed -i "22s/dev/$pkgver/" "main.go" - go get -u github.com/golang/dep/... - go get -u github.com/pierrre/gotestcover dep ensure } build() { export GOPATH="$srcdir/.go" cd "$srcdir/$_repodir/$pkgname" - make + make build } -# Test fails -#check() { - #export GOPATH="$srcdir/.go" - #export PATH="$GOPATH/bin:$PATH" - #cd "$srcdir/$_repodir/$pkgname" - #make test -#} +check() { + export GOPATH="$srcdir/.go" + cd "$srcdir/$_repodir/$pkgname" + make test +} package() { cd "$srcdir/$pkgname-$pkgver" |